Description
HADLOW CARPENTERS LAKE TQ 65 SW 3/12 Bourne Mill Cottage 23.9.74 II
Former miller's house. It is said to have been originally a bakery attached to the nearby mill. C18 origins, converted to a miller's house in the mid C19, refurbished with studio addition circa 1974; white-washed brick; brick stacks and chimneyshafts; slate roof to the main house, rest is peg-tile.
Plan: House faces south south east, say south. it has a 2-room plan, one room each side of central entrance hall and staircase. If the left (west) room was heated the stack is now disused. The right room has a rear lateral stack which also serves the lean-to outshot that end. C20 studio addition on right end built as a crosswing flush with the front and with an outer lateral stack.
House is 2 storeys, the studio is single storey but built as high as the main house, and outbuildings to right (east) now used as a garage.
Exterior: Main house as a symmetrical 3-window front. Each side are mid/late C19 full height canted bay windows containing horned sashes, 12-panes to front and 8-panes each side. First floor centre a rounded headed window with glazing bars over the doorway which contains a C19 6-panel door behind a low pitch gabled porch on plain posts. Low pitch roof is hipped both ends. Studio front has full height round-headed window with glazing bars and roof is hipped. Lower outbuilding to right has blind wall to front and hipped roof.
Interior: Not inspected.
